STATE v. WALKER

No. 20417.

867 P.2d 244 (1993)

125 Idaho 11

STATE of Idaho, Plaintiff-Respondent, v. Leslie Stanley WALKER, Defendant-Appellant.

Court of Appeals of Idaho.

Petition for Review Denied February 15, 1994.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Alan E. Trimming, Ada County Public Defender, Deborah A. Whipple, Deputy Public Defender, Boise, for appellant.

Larry EchoHawk, Atty. Gen., Myrna A.I. Stahman, Deputy Atty. Gen., Boise, for respondent.


WALTERS, Chief Judge.

This is a sentence review. Pursuant to a plea bargain, Leslie Stanley Walker pled guilty to second degree kidnapping. I.C. §§ 18-4501, -4503. The court imposed a unified sentence of twenty-five years with a fifteen-year minimum period of confinement. We affirm.
